Getting employed is no longer an easy task for undergraduate students. That is why some have taken the initiative to work for free internship, to beat against the odds of finding a job. Some experts say this only does more harm than good to undergraduate students, because they are actually selling short of themselves. What is your opinion? Should undergraduate students work for free internship to get a job offer? Write an essay of about 400 words. You should supply an appropriate title for your essay.

Unpaid Internship Pays Off
Two years ago, when one of my friends graduated from university, she took an unpaid internship in a company. I was skeptical about this internship offer. Three months later, owing to her excellent performance, she was hired as a regular employee with a handsome salary. It was then that I changed my attitude. Free internship would be worthwhile if it’s one’s dream job or related to one’s life ambition.
To start with, an unpaid internship can be viewed as a stepping stone to a career field one aspires after. It’s not easy to get a desirable job in this bleak job market. The situation is even gloomier if one’s ambition lies in such high-profile industries as journalism, publishing, advertising and so on. In order to enter these professions, working experience is more than often a must Thus, it is advisable for undergraduates to regard a free internship as a foot in the door of their ideal career.
Secondly, by taking an unpaid internship, undergraduates are not selling short of themselves as those experts said. On the contrary, they are showing real determination and perseverance to work hard. One common weakness among youngsters is a desire for quick returns. The willingness to take a free internship demonstrates to some extent that one is a sound employee with one’s feet on the ground, not eager for instant benefit. Those undergraduates who take free internship are able to look beyond tangible gains and have far sight, knowing that a temporary concession will bring more benefit in the long run. They will be welcomed by most employers.
Finally, young graduates should consider free internships as an opportunity to accumulate working experience and social connections, which might give them a competitive edge. Interns may be doing something as trivial as typing and photocopying that makes them question the value of the internship, especially when no income is earned. However, through keen observation and active communication, they can make new friends and obtain a wide range of knowledge of the desired profession, which is intangible benefit to interns.
Maybe what people are concerning about unpaid internships is whether the employer is taking advantage of innocent students for free labor. We cannot rule out this possibility and governmental supervisors should try hard to regulate employers’ behaviors. For undergraduates, if they find a way into a well-established company, they should hold the faith that the legitimately unpaid internship will eventually pay off.
